Adaptive vs a static goal
MyFitnessPal gives you a fixed target from a one-time formula — it doesn't self-correct as your real burn changes. Our Macro back-calculates your true TDEE from your weight trend and re-fits it every week, so the number keeps fitting you. How adaptive TDEE works →
